MCCAIN USES RACIAL SLUR ON CAMPAIGN TRAIL
Per the Des Moines Register:
Cedar Falls, Ia. - Republican presidential candidate John McCain used the term "tar baby," which is sometimes associated with racist connotations, during a campaign stop in northern Iowa on Friday and immediately expressed regret.
The Arizona senator was answering a question during a Cedar Falls forum in front of 500 Republicans in Black Hawk County when he used the same words that drew criticism last year when uttered by GOP presidential candidate Mitt Romney and White House spokesman Tony Snow.
"For me to stand here before all these people and say I'm going to declare divorces invalid because someone feels they weren't treated fairly in court, we are getting into a tar baby of enormous proportions," McCain said, explaining his position on the federal government's role in parental rights in custody cases.
